Freestanding Tub Installation Cost Factors Explained

A freestanding tub reads as the simple option. No alcove to frame, no tile flange, no three-wall surround to waterproof. In practice, though, installation effort varies more than for almost any other fixture in a Canadian bathroom, and the real freestanding tub installation cost factors are site conditions, not the tub itself. Here is what actually drives the work, so you can plan trades and sequencing before you order.

Drain location does the most work

Every freestanding tub has a fixed drain position, and the rough-in under your floor has to meet it within a small tolerance. If you are replacing an existing freestanding or clawfoot tub and the new drain lands close to the old one, the plumbing side is often a modest job. If you are converting from an alcove tub, shifting the tub to a new spot, or floating it in the centre of the room, the drain has to move, and that means opening the floor.

How hard that is depends on what sits underneath. A main-floor bathroom over an unfinished basement, common across the Prairies and much of suburban Canada, gives a plumber easy access from below and keeps the job contained. A second-storey bathroom over a finished ceiling, a concrete-slab condo in Vancouver or Toronto, or a slab-on-grade home in the Maritimes each push the same task into heavier territory: cutting concrete, patching the ceiling below, or rerouting within a tight joist bay. Venting has to be sorted at the same time. The National Plumbing Code sets the framework, but provincial and municipal rules govern the details, so this is a licensed-plumber conversation to have early, not late. Floor structure and tub weight

A freestanding tub concentrates its load on a small footprint, and the number that matters is the filled weight: tub, water, and bather together. Acrylic tubs from makers like Maax and Kalia are the lightest of the group and rarely raise structural questions. Stone resin, solid surface and cast iron sit at the other end. A cast iron soaker from a brand like Cheviot can be several times the weight of an acrylic tub before any water goes in.

In newer construction this is usually a non-issue. In older housing stock, from century homes in Quebec to wartime houses in Halifax, a contractor may want to sister joists or add blocking under the tub location, which is simple while the floor is open and disruptive after. Levelling matters too, since freestanding tubs show an out-of-level floor plainly.

The tub filler decision changes the plumbing scope

Freestanding tubs rarely have a deck to mount taps on, so you are choosing between a wall-mounted filler, practical when the tub sits near a wall, and a floor-mounted filler rising beside the tub. The floor-mounted version is the most demanding rough-in in the bathroom: supply lines come up through the floor at an exact spot, the riser has to be anchored solidly to structure, and everything must be pressure-tested before the finished floor goes down. Air systems bring an electrician into it

A plain soaker is purely a plumbing job. An air tub, the kind Bain Ultra is known for, adds a blower that needs its own dedicated, protected circuit and an access provision for future service. That means an electrician, a permit in most jurisdictions, and an added inspection step. None of it is exotic, but it changes the project from one trade to two, so confirm the electrical requirements from the spec sheet before rough-in.

When DIY is realistic, and when it is not

Honest answer: placing the tub is the easy part, and the rough-in is the hard part.

  • Realistic DIY territory: a like-for-like swap where the existing drain lines up, a lightweight acrylic tub, an existing wall-mounted filler staying put, and accessible plumbing connections. Confident DIYers handle this with a helper for the lift.
  • Pro territory: relocating a drain, any slab or finished-ceiling situation, a floor-mounted filler rough-in, cast iron or stone tubs, and anything involving electrical. In most provinces, plumbing and electrical alterations require permits and, in many cases, licensed trades, and an unpermitted rough-in can surface at resale or on an insurance claim.

Whatever the scope, plan a two-person lift, measure every doorway and stair turn on the delivery path, and check warranty terms, since some manufacturers require professional installation for coverage.

Sequencing in a renovation

Freestanding tubs punish late decisions. The order that keeps a reno smooth looks like this:

  1. Choose the tub first. The drain location, filled weight and filler type drive everything downstream, so the spec sheet needs to exist before rough-in.
  2. Rough-in plumbing and any electrical while the floor and walls are open, including the floor-filler supplies if you are using one.
  3. Structural work and subfloor, then inspection where required.
  4. Finished flooring runs under the tub, wall to wall. Unlike an alcove tub, there is no hiding an unfinished edge.
  5. Set the tub, connect the drain, then mount the filler and test everything before the room is called done.

One cold-climate note worth building into the plan: keep supply lines out of exterior walls wherever possible. A filler fed through an outside wall in a Winnipeg or Edmonton winter is a freeze risk that good routing avoids entirely. And if your tub arrives by freight in January, give it time to come up to room temperature before installation.

Buying with the install in mind

When you compare models, look past the silhouette. Confirm the fixture carries cUPC or CSA certification for use in Canada, download the specification sheet and check the drain position, filled weight and clearance recommendations, and think about how the tub reaches your bathroom, not just your driveway. Frequently asked questions

Can I install a freestanding tub myself?

If the existing drain lines up, the filler is already on the wall, and the tub is lightweight acrylic, a capable DIYer with a helper can do it. The moment the job involves moving a drain, opening a slab, roughing in a floor-mounted filler, or adding a circuit for an air system, it belongs with licensed trades.

Does a freestanding tub need to be anchored to the floor?

It depends on the model. Many manufacturers require securing the tub with brackets or adhesive, and floor-mounted fillers must always be anchored to structure, never just to finished flooring. Follow the installation manual, since anchoring requirements affect warranty coverage.

When in a renovation should I buy the tub?

Before plumbing rough-in, and ideally before demolition planning is final. The tub's drain position, filled weight and filler pairing dictate where pipes go and whether structure needs reinforcing. Having the tub, or at least its spec sheet, on site at rough-in prevents reopening finished floors and ceilings later.

Do freestanding tubs work on upper floors?

Usually, yes. Most modern framing handles an acrylic freestanding tub without modification. Heavier materials like cast iron and stone resin on an upper floor of an older home deserve a look from a contractor or structural professional first, ideally while walls and floors are already open.
